Output 7d405631e3713409ff90252c07c27afbe53c66becbe3adc5957807537ab72e0c:1

value
499365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c0caf4995304cc39d8ab5211f274a7ff9fd1959 OP_EQUAL
address
3CzvugQinS7vhcDdAe1LNBg7v9cFADXqw4
transaction
7d405631e3713409ff90252c07c27afbe53c66becbe3adc5957807537ab72e0c
spent
true